Professor Archibald T. Davison '06 will give an organ recital at 5 o'clock this afternoon in Appleton Chapel. This is the fourth of a series being given in Appleton Chapel and in the chapel of the Andover Theological Seminary on Francis avenue. The recitals are open to the public.
Miss Helen C. Curtis, Radcliffe '22, violinist, will assist Professor Davison in the rendition of the following program:
Allegro (Sixth Symphony), Widor
Choral Preludes, Brahms
"O how blessed, faithful Spirits are ye."
"Lo, how a Rose e'er blooming."
"O world, I e'en must leave thee."
